				 Re: Megagame 2009 
 A megagame is all the nations in one singe game, so that's what? about 70 or so?It's not a team game, but you'll be foolish if you don't make any alliances in a game of that scale.
 I missed it the last time due to traveling but I'm here for this one (if it get's organized).
